Helen F Swanson 1918 - 1979

Helen F Swanson was born on July 14, 1918, and died at age 60 years old on April 28, 1979. Helen Swanson was buried at Calverton National Cemetery Section 4 Site 3357 210 Princeton Boulevard - Rt 25, in Calverton, Ny. In 1920, by the time she was only 2 years old, in September, a bomb exploded in the J.P. Morgan bank building in New York City, killing 30 people immediately - 8 later died due to their injuries - and injuring another 200. Killing more people than the 1910 bombing of the LA Times (the deadliest terrorist act up until then), no one took responsibility and the perpetrators were never found. Italian anarchists were suspected of the bombing.
